Giant Soap Bubble Solution. 3 cups water. 1 cup liquid dishwashing detergent. 1/2 cup white corn syrup. By adding corn syrup to a basic soap bubble recipe you create a sugar polymer and a much stronger bubble that is able to live long enough … WebJan 19, 2024 · The colder the solution is, the quicker the bubble will freeze. A useful tip when preparing to freeze soap bubbles. The bottles I was planning on using were kept in fridge, since the colder the solution is, the quicker the bubble will freeze. WebJan 20, 2024 · Technically, you can make frozen bubbles at any temperature below freezing. However, cold temps close to freezing can mean the bubble takes a long time to freeze. It will then most likely … WebJul 3, 2024 · When a bubble is in a freezing environment and lands on a cold surface, the first thing to freeze is the bottom of the bubble. As this freeze front expands, it releases latent heat into the ...
